Heavy rainfall is not the only source of flooding. Internal issues like burst pipes and also overflows can cause emergency situation flooding. This will additionally create damage to your residential or commercial property. Failing to resolve the trouble will certainly intensify the damage and raise the opportunities of mold and mildew growth. Keep on reviewing to learn what you can when handling emergency flooding.

1. Shut Off Main Water Shutoff

Pipes can burst as a result of freezing temps, high pressure, clog, hot water heater issues, as well as various other factors. Regardless of the reason, you must act swiftly to make certain porous home materials, home appliances, as well as furnishings do not take in the water, leading to damage. Shut off the major shutoff before you do any cleansing to ensure water stops gathering. Eliminating the water source is basic, and also it is something you can do yourself. As for the burst pipeline, ask for emergency situation pipes services to repair it immediately.

2. Shut down the Breaker

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Move Important Wet Times

When it comes to conserving your home furnishings as well as appliances, time is of the essence. Therefore, you need to move whatever sharpen items you can from the afflicted area to a completely dry area. This discourages more damage since the longer they take in water, the much more considerable the problem.

4. Record the Extent of Damage

Take note of all the damage caused by the ruptured pipeline. You can write down notes, take photos, as well as gather video clips. This is a wonderful way to supply proof to gather cases on your residence insurance policy protection. With paperwork, you can additionally obtain a clear photo of the degree of the damage.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You should get rid of excess water as soon as possible. Need to there be a big qu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for removal. When marginal water is left, you can saturate up the remainder with old t-sh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Location

You can additionally set up electric followers as well as placed them in the best setting. A dehumidifier additionally functions in taking out moisture to protect against mildew and also molds.

7. Collaborate with Experts

When you endure substantial water damages because of emergency situation fl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a remediation expert to reconstruct as well as restore your home. Above all, do not neglect to call a respectable plumber to repair the burst pipe as well as check the rest of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will certainly be rendered worthless.

Surviving the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one location, you need to be utilized now on what to do, where to go and also what to have to be gotten ready for negative climate. However, if you're not utilized to getting pummeled by high winds as well as difficult rain, you probably don't have an idea how ideal to deal with a tornado circumstance.

For beginners, storms do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ep an eye on the ambience everyday. If a storm is feasible, they will certainly provide 2 sorts of cautions: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ible tornado in your area.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an uncommonly gusty day and also some rainfall. The storm may or may not come, yet this is the time to keep tuned to your local radio for news and updates.

Tornado warning-- is released when a storm is headed toward your area. By that time, the streets might be flooded and web traffic is bad. You don't desire to be captured in your auto in bad weather condition.

Blizzard-- typically takes place in winter season as well as implies hefty snow, solid winds and wind cool. When a caution is released, stay clear of traveling as long as possible as well as stay inside. There is no usage subjecting yourself outdoors where you could obtain entraped in web traffic or in places where you will certainly be hard to get to or worse, find.

For all our innovation, no one can quit a tornado from coming. The only method to survive it is to be prepared to face the emergency situation. Points don't constantly go bad during tornados, however weather is uncertain as well as anything can happen. To assist you prepare for a storm emergency, right here are a couple of suggestions:

Dress up.
Use sufficient clothing to maintain on your own cozy. Warm might not be readily available in your residence so get additional layers and also coverings to keep your body temperature sufficiently.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ots prepared as well.

Have food all set.
Emergency situation arrangements are a should during tornado emergencies. If the storm obtains also poor as well as the roads are swamped,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ery shops.

Maintain containers of water handy. Tidy water may be hard to find by throughout actually bad problems and also the worst point you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of a minimum of one gallon for every single individ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ing and also purging the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't operate, so best fill your tub, water containers and also jugs with water. If you have kids in your house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and also keeping children far from the washroom unless required.

Emergency package
Have a clinical or initial package prepared as well as ensure it's freshly-stocked. It ought to have an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also required medicines. It's likewise a great concept to have an additional kit in your automobile.

If any person in your family is under unique medication, make certain you have adequate products to last until after the tornado is over and also drug shops are open.

Lights off
Expect power outages during tornado emergencies. You won't have any power, so supply on candles, flashlights and also em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ries and also matches in case you go out.

If you can't turn on the television,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your location. Media will certainly keep an eye on the storm and also will keep you updated.

You may require hot water during the period when power is not yet offered, so keep a small storage tank of gas about just in case. Your exterior gas grill will certainly do nicely.

Obtain an alternate shelter.
If you think your house will certainly experience substantially, it's a good idea to think about an alternating shelter. Maybe an emptying facility or an additional house or building that is safer. Make sure you have adequate gas in your container in case you need to leave your house and relocation some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have far better opportunities of being secure and completely dry.
